Paris Saint-Germain faced Arsenal this Saturday at the Puskas Arena in the 2026 Champions League final (1-1, 3-4 on penalties, video highlights here). On the sidelines of the match, Luis Enrique, the capital club’s coach, spoke to PSG TV about the game.

Luis Enrique: “It’s time to celebrate with our supporters.”

“It’s even stronger because we knew before the match how difficult it would be to play against Arsenal. For us, as a team and as a city, it’s incredible to win on merit over the course of the whole season. The final was very closely contested. But now it’s time to celebrate with our supporters.”

A historic result for PSG, who claimed their second Champions League title and cemented their place in the legend of both French and European football. At the end of a tight, stop-start, and not particularly spectacular match, PSG managed to pull ahead right at the end of the penalty shootout.

After Arsenal’s goal in the first half, it was hard to imagine this Paris side finding a way through against such a compact block. By raising their level and the intensity they put into the match, the Parisians eventually managed to equalize in the second half.

It may not have been the most spectacular match of the season, but the outcome is what matters, and PSG completed the back-to-back. Now firmly part of European football history, the Parisians can savor this new trophy, won at the very end through sheer effort and perseverance.
